Who should consult a physician before receiving a tattoo?

  1. Anyone under 18

  2. Only pregnant people

  3. People with allergies

  4. Both pregnant people and people with allergies

The correct answer is: Both pregnant people and people with allergies

Consulting a physician before receiving a tattoo is particularly important for individuals with specific health concerns, as certain conditions can increase the risk of complications from the tattooing process. Pregnant individuals should seek medical advice because of potential risks to both the mother and the developing fetus, including infection and exposure to toxins in ink. Furthermore, people with allergies may be at risk of having reactions to tattoo inks or the materials used in the tattooing process. Allergic reactions could manifest as skin irritations, rashes, or more severe hypersensitive responses. Considering these health considerations, the combined recommendation for both pregnant individuals and those with allergies emphasizes the need for a personalized assessment of health risks prior to proceeding with a tattoo. Therefore, it is essential for anyone in these categories to discuss their specific concerns with a healthcare professional before getting tattooed.
